How can I delete all photos attached to icons in a markup easily?
Afternoon All,
We have custom tool chest icons with photos attached to them on our markups. There are up to 200 icons on a markup, which for some reporting we want to remove all photos.
Can anyone suggest how to delete all the photos in a single action? It is very time consuming to delete individual photos from each icon and we can't find another way to do this.
Alternatively, if there is a way to exclude them from a batch summary, this would work also. I haven't found a way to do this either.

This isn't the answer you're looking for, but I have a workaround for you:
Hold CTRL and drag your markup to make a duplicate. The duplicate will not have any captures associated with it. Then you can delete the original and the new one will have all the same properties.1 -

Great thought. It doesn't work for any icons that are sequenced unfortunately. The majority of our icons are sequenced unfortunately.
